Research
Brian's research applies bioanalytical chemistry, biophysical chemistry, and surface chemistry techniques towards the development of biosensors, biomaterials, and medical devices. Applications of interest include bioterrorism surveillance, point-of-care detection of pathogenic microorganisms, and other national security needs.
